这款游戏不仅仅是一款沙盒建造游戏,更是一个融合了探索、冒险、创造与生存的多元宇宙
而在这个多元宇宙的背后,原生服务器MC(Minecraft Server)扮演着至关重要的角色,它不仅是连接玩家与游戏世界的桥梁,更是游戏体验深度与广度的决定性因素
本文将深入探讨原生服务器MC的重要性、构建原理、优化策略及其对游戏社区的影响,旨在揭示这一看似平凡却至关重要的游戏基础设施背后的非凡力量
原生服务器MC:游戏世界的灵魂 《我的世界》之所以能够吸引全球数亿玩家,其开放性和自由度是核心所在
玩家可以在一个由方块构成的三维世界中自由建造、挖掘、战斗和探索
然而,这一切精彩纷呈的体验,都离不开原生服务器MC的支撑
原生服务器不仅是数据存储的中心,负责保存玩家的游戏进度、创造的作品、以及游戏内的经济系统等关键信息,它还是游戏逻辑的执行者,确保游戏规则得以正确实施,从物理引擎的运作到生物行为的模拟,无一不依赖服务器的精确计算
更重要的是,原生服务器MC是玩家社交互动的基石
无论是与朋友在私人服务器上共同建造梦想家园,还是在公共服务器上参与大型多人在线活动,如团队生存挑战、服务器战争等,服务器的稳定性和性能直接影响着玩家的游戏体验
一个高效、稳定的服务器能够促进玩家间的互动,增强游戏的社区感,反之则可能导致玩家流失,影响游戏的生命力
构建原理:技术与艺术的融合 构建原生服务器MC,是一项融合了计算机科学、网络技术和游戏设计的复杂工程
首先,服务器架构的选择至关重要
根据服务器的规模(如玩家数量、地图大小)、预期负载和预算,开发者需要决定是采用单机服务器、集群服务器还是云服务
单机服务器适合小规模、低负载的场景,而集群服务器和云服务则能提供更好的扩展性和高可用性,适用于大型服务器或需要24小时不间断运行的情况
其次,服务器的硬件配置也不容忽视
高效的CPU、充足的内存、快速的存储设备以及稳定的网络连接,都是确保服务器性能的关键
此外,针对《我的世界》的特性,优化服务器软件(如Spigot、Forge等)的选择和配置也是提升服务器效率的重要手段
这些优化软件能够减少服务器资源的消耗,提高游戏世界的加载速度,甚至支持自定义插件,为服务器增添更多功能和玩法
优化策略:追求极致体验 优化原生服务器MC,不仅关乎硬件配置和软件选择,更在于持续的性能监控和调优
以下几点是提升服务器性能的关键策略: 1.垃圾回收优化:Java虚拟机(JVM)的垃圾回收机制对服务器性能有显著影响
通过调整JVM参数,如堆大小、垃圾回收器等,可以有效减少卡顿现象
2.网络优化:使用低延迟、高吞吐量的网络协议,如TCP优化或UDP,以及部署CDN(内容分发网络),可以减少玩家与服务器之间的延迟,提升游戏流畅度
3.世